How To Install python3-barman on Rocky Linux 8

In this tutorial we learn how to install python3-barman on Rocky Linux 8. python3-barman is Shared libraries for Barman

Introduction

In this tutorial we learn how to install python3-barman on Rocky Linux 8.

What is python3-barman

Python libraries used by Barman.

We can use yum or dnf to install python3-barman on Rocky Linux 8. In this tutorial we discuss both methods but you only need to choose one of method to install python3-barman.

Install python3-barman on Rocky Linux 8 Using dnf

Update yum database with dnf using the following command.

sudo dnf makecache --refresh

After updating yum database, We can install python3-barman using dnf by running the following command:

sudo dnf -y install python3-barman

Install python3-barman on Rocky Linux 8 Using yum

Update yum database with yum using the following command.

sudo yum makecache --refresh

After updating yum database, We can install python3-barman using yum by running the following command:

sudo yum -y install python3-barman

How To Uninstall python3-barman on Rocky Linux 8

To uninstall only the python3-barman package we can use the following command:

sudo dnf remove python3-barman

python3-barman Package Contents on Rocky Linux 8

/usr/lib/python3.6/site-packages/barman
/usr/lib/python3.6/site-packages/barman-2.12-py3.6.egg-info
/usr/lib/python3.6/site-packages/barman-2.12-py3.6.egg-info/PKG-INFO
/usr/lib/python3.6/site-packages/barman-2.12-py3.6.egg-info/SOURCES.txt
/usr/lib/python3.6/site-packages/barman-2.12-py3.6.egg-info/dependency_links.txt
/usr/lib/python3.6/site-packages/barman-2.12-py3.6.egg-info/entry_points.txt
/usr/lib/python3.6/site-packages/barman-2.12-py3.6.egg-info/requires.txt
/usr/lib/python3.6/site-packages/barman-2.12-py3.6.egg-info/top_level.txt
/usr/lib/python3.6/site-packages/barman/__init__.py
/usr/lib/python3.6/site-packages/barman/__pycache__
/usr/lib/python3.6/site-packages/barman/__pycache__/__init__.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/__init__.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/backup.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/backup.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/backup_executor.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/backup_executor.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/cli.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/cli.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/cloud.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/cloud.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/command_wrappers.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/command_wrappers.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/compression.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/compression.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/config.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/config.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/copy_controller.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/copy_controller.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/diagnose.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/diagnose.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/exceptions.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/exceptions.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/fs.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/fs.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/hooks.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/hooks.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/infofile.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/infofile.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/lockfile.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/lockfile.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/output.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/output.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/postgres.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/postgres.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/postgres_plumbing.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/postgres_plumbing.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/process.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/process.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/recovery_executor.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/recovery_executor.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/remote_status.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/remote_status.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/retention_policies.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/retention_policies.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/server.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/server.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/utils.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/utils.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/version.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/version.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/wal_archiver.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/wal_archiver.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/xlog.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/__pycache__/xlog.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/backup.py
/usr/lib/python3.6/site-packages/barman/backup_executor.py
/usr/lib/python3.6/site-packages/barman/cli.py
/usr/lib/python3.6/site-packages/barman/clients
/usr/lib/python3.6/site-packages/barman/clients/__init__.py
/usr/lib/python3.6/site-packages/barman/clients/__pycache__
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/__init__.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/__init__.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/cloud_backup.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/cloud_backup.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/cloud_backup_list.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/cloud_backup_list.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/cloud_restore.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/cloud_restore.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/cloud_walarchive.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/cloud_walarchive.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/cloud_walrestore.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/cloud_walrestore.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/walarchive.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/walarchive.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/walrestore.cpython-36.opt-1.pyc
/usr/lib/python3.6/site-packages/barman/clients/__pycache__/walrestore.cpython-36.pyc
/usr/lib/python3.6/site-packages/barman/clients/cloud_backup.py
/usr/lib/python3.6/site-packages/barman/clients/cloud_backup_list.py
/usr/lib/python3.6/site-packages/barman/clients/cloud_restore.py
/usr/lib/python3.6/site-packages/barman/clients/cloud_walarchive.py
/usr/lib/python3.6/site-packages/barman/clients/cloud_walrestore.py
/usr/lib/python3.6/site-packages/barman/clients/walarchive.py
/usr/lib/python3.6/site-packages/barman/clients/walrestore.py
/usr/lib/python3.6/site-packages/barman/cloud.py
/usr/lib/python3.6/site-packages/barman/command_wrappers.py
/usr/lib/python3.6/site-packages/barman/compression.py
/usr/lib/python3.6/site-packages/barman/config.py
/usr/lib/python3.6/site-packages/barman/copy_controller.py
/usr/lib/python3.6/site-packages/barman/diagnose.py
/usr/lib/python3.6/site-packages/barman/exceptions.py
/usr/lib/python3.6/site-packages/barman/fs.py
/usr/lib/python3.6/site-packages/barman/hooks.py
/usr/lib/python3.6/site-packages/barman/infofile.py
/usr/lib/python3.6/site-packages/barman/lockfile.py
/usr/lib/python3.6/site-packages/barman/output.py
/usr/lib/python3.6/site-packages/barman/postgres.py
/usr/lib/python3.6/site-packages/barman/postgres_plumbing.py
/usr/lib/python3.6/site-packages/barman/process.py
/usr/lib/python3.6/site-packages/barman/recovery_executor.py
/usr/lib/python3.6/site-packages/barman/remote_status.py
/usr/lib/python3.6/site-packages/barman/retention_policies.py
/usr/lib/python3.6/site-packages/barman/server.py
/usr/lib/python3.6/site-packages/barman/utils.py
/usr/lib/python3.6/site-packages/barman/version.py
/usr/lib/python3.6/site-packages/barman/wal_archiver.py
/usr/lib/python3.6/site-packages/barman/xlog.py
/usr/share/doc/python3-barman
/usr/share/doc/python3-barman/NEWS
/usr/share/doc/python3-barman/README.rst
/usr/share/licenses/python3-barman
/usr/share/licenses/python3-barman/LICENSE

References

Summary

In this tutorial we learn how to install python3-barman on Rocky Linux 8 using yum and dnf.